Experience of hydrogeophysical research in studying the problem of groundwater protection
Abstract
Nowadays hydrogeophysical methods are more and more widely used in the practice of hydrological surveys. At the same time, there are often situations when the staging of geophysical work does not take into account the specifics of specific hydrogeological studies and is largely formal ....
